桌面型数据库软件有哪些
以桌面型数据库软件为中心,我们将介绍几种常见的桌面型数据库软件。这些软件可以帮助用户有效地管理和组织数据,提供高效的数据存储和检索功能。
让我们来介绍一下Microsoft Access。作为微软公司开发的一款强大而灵活的桌面型数据库管理系统,Microsoft Access被广泛应用于各个领域。它具有友好的用户界面和丰富的功能集合,使得用户可以轻松创建、编辑和查询数据库。它还支持多种数据类型,并提供了丰富的报表生成工具。
其次是FileMaker Pro。FileMaker Pro是一款跨平台的桌面型数据库软件,在Mac OS和Windows操作系统上都有广泛应用。它以其简单易用、灵活性强等特点受到了很多用户的喜爱。FileMaker Pro不仅可以帮助用户快速构建自定义数据库解决方案,还支持与其他应用程序集成,并提供了丰富多样化的模板库。
另外一个值得一提的是SQLite。SQLite是一个开源、轻量级但功能强大的嵌入式关系型数据库引擎,在移动设备等资源受限环境中得到广泛使用。SQLite具有小巧高效、无服务器架构等特点,可以在不需要独立服务器的情况下直接嵌入到应用程序中。它支持标准SQL语法,并提供了丰富的API和工具。
我们来介绍一下OpenOffice Base。OpenOffice Base是开源办公套件OpenOffice中的一个组件,它提供了一种简单易用的方式来创建和管理数据库。OpenOffice Base支持多种数据库引擎,并且可以与其他OpenOffice组件无缝集成。它具有友好的用户界面、强大的查询功能以及报表生成工具。
桌面型数据库软件为用户提供了方便快捷地管理和组织数据的解决方案。无论是Microsoft Access、FileMaker Pro、SQLite还是OpenOffice Base,都具有各自独特的特点和优势,在不同场景下能够满足用户对于数据处理需求的要求。
桌面型数据库软件有哪些类型
桌面型数据库软件是一种用于管理和组织数据的应用程序。它们通常安装在个人电脑上,用户可以使用这些软件来创建、编辑和查询数据库。根据其功能和特点,桌面型数据库软件可以分为以下几种类型。
关系型数据库软件:关系型数据库软件是最常见的一类桌面型数据库软件。它们使用表格结构来存储数据,并通过定义表之间的关系来建立数据之间的联系。例如,Microsoft Access、MySQL 和 PostgreSQL 都属于关系型数据库软件。
对象式数据库软件:对象式数据库软件将数据以对象的形式进行存储和管理。与传统的关系模型不同,对象模型更加灵活,能够更好地表示现实世界中复杂的实体和关联性。例如,ObjectDB 和 Versant Object Database 是两个常见的对象式数据库软件。
文档型数据库软件:文档型数据库主要用于存储半结构化或非结构化数据(如 JSON 或 XML 格式)。这些数据以文档集合(collection)或键值对(key-value)形式进行组织,并支持复杂查询操作。MongoDB 和 Couchbase 是两个流行的文档型数据库。
图形化/网络图形库:图形化数据库软件用于存储和处理图形数据,如网络拓扑、地理信息系统(GIS)数据等。这些软件提供了专门的功能和算法来支持图形操作,例如节点之间的连接、路径查找等。Neo4j 和 ArangoDB 是两个常见的图形化数据库软件。
时间序列数据库软件:时间序列数据库主要用于存储和分析按照时间顺序排列的数据,如传感器数据、股票交易记录等。它们具有高效的插入和查询性能,并提供了特定的函数和工具来处理时间相关操作。InfluxDB 和 TimescaleDB 是两个常见的时间序列数据库软件。
桌面型数据库软件根据其类型可以分为关系型、对象式、文档型、图形化/网络图形库以及时间序列等多种类型。每种类型都有其特定领域和应用场景,在不同需求下选择合适类型的桌面型数据库软件能够更好地满足用户需求。
桌面型数据库软件有哪些特点
桌面型数据库软件是一种用于管理和存储数据的应用程序。它们具有许多特点,使其成为处理和分析数据的理想选择。
桌面型数据库软件具有易于使用的界面。这些软件通常提供直观的用户界面,使用户能够轻松地创建、编辑和查询数据库。无论是初学者还是专业人士都可以快速上手,并且不需要编写复杂的代码。
桌面型数据库软件具有灵活性和可扩展性。它们允许用户根据自己的需求自定义表格、字段和关系。用户可以根据需要添加新字段或修改现有字段,并且可以轻松地建立表之间的关联关系。这些软件还支持各种数据类型(如文本、数字、日期等),以满足不同类型数据存储与分析需求。
第三,桌面型数据库软件提供了强大而灵活的查询功能。通过使用结构化查询语言(SQL),用户可以轻松地执行复杂查询操作并获取所需结果。这些软件通常提供图形化工具来帮助用户构建查询语句,并且支持各种条件筛选、排序和聚合函数等功能。
桌面型数据库软件还具有数据安全性和备份功能。用户可以设置访问权限,以确保只有授权人员能够查看和修改数据库。这些软件通常提供自动备份功能,以防止数据丢失或损坏。
桌面型数据库软件还具有良好的性能和响应速度。它们经过优化,可以处理大量的数据,并且在查询和分析时能够快速响应。
桌面型数据库软件是一种强大而灵活的工具,在管理和分析数据方面发挥着重要作用。它们易于使用、灵活可扩展、提供强大的查询功能、保证数据安全并具有良好的性能表现。
本文地址:https://gpu.xuandashi.com/95300.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!